Two Teens Arrested for Robbery

The following information was provided by the Portsmouth Police log. An arrest does not indicate a conviction.

The following is an excerpt from the Portsmouth Police log from Thursday, Dec. 12.

Thursday:

  • At 11:54 a.m., police reported criminal mischief on Penhallow Street after someone had painted on a building.
  • At 12:30 p.m., police reported the theft of an iPhone on Parrott Avenue with a suspect.
  • At 4:02 p.m., police reported criminal mischief on Wedgewood Road after the caller said someone had cut the rear brake lines on his vehicle.
  • At 4:12 p.m., police issued an all points bulletin to help find a female juvenile who has sucidal tendencies after she left one of her parents' homes on Winsor Road.
  • At 6:35 p.m., police arrested two male juveniles, ages 16 and 15, and charged them with robbery after they allegedy assaulted the caller on Freedom Circle.
  • At 7:08 p.m., police arrested a Portsmouth woman on Islington Street. Kathering Szusazana Anderson, 63, of 26 Blue Heron Drive was charged with theft.
